[quote]Earlier this summer, we found traces of code within the Source Filmmaker that clearly indicated Valve is actively working on “Source 2“, a next-gen game engine built on Source’s foundation. While the news made quite a stir all throughout the Valve community, it didn’t have the same effect it would have had, if Valve had officially confirmed Source 2′s existence.
Well, some months later, it appears we finally have been given just that. Read on!
A week ago, on the 3rd of November, a large group of fans from 4chan’s game-centric imageboard, /v/, came over to visit Valve on Gabe’s birthday. They brought with them this absolutely colossal birthday card, as well as a very unique Team Fortress-themed birthday present: an actual real-life Mann Co Crate, which, just like the one from Team Fortress 2… was locked. The best part? Gabe had to pay $2.50 for a key. But it all paid off in the end, as Gabe “uncrated” a combat helmet, similar to the one the Soldier wears in TF2.
After the crate was unlocked, Gabe stayed to talk with the fans in Valve’s lobby, alongside his colleague, Erik Johnson. A full, 52-minute video of the birthday visit can be found on YouTube, here. We’re going to quote one of the more interesting exchanges, which you can find starting at approximately 6:10 in the aforementioned video:
Fan: Is Valve potentially already working on a new engine?
Fan: Source 2? Could or… could not be?
Gabe Newell: We’ve been working on Valve’s new engine stuff for a while, we’re probably just [incomprehensible, subtitled as: "waiting for a game to roll it out with"]
Fan: Is it going to be more than just an extension to Source? Is it an entirely new engine?
Gabe Newell: Yeah!
Quite intriguing… strange how he was so candid about it. Still, it’s all right there in the video, and considering what we found in the SFM files three months ago, I would dare say that Source 2 is most certainly in development, and perhaps not so far from its launch.
